对象存储实战指南 pdf,对象存储实战指南(PDF版)完整解析,从技术原理到企业级应用全流程
- 综合资讯
- 2025-05-08 21:13:04
- 1

《对象存储实战指南(PDF版)》系统解析对象存储核心技术体系,覆盖分布式架构设计、数据存储模型、高可用性保障、数据安全策略等核心模块,全书以"技术原理-架构设计-企业级...
《对象存储实战指南(PDF版)》系统解析对象存储核心技术体系,覆盖分布式架构设计、数据存储模型、高可用性保障、数据安全策略等核心模块,全书以"技术原理-架构设计-企业级应用"为逻辑主线,深入讲解对象存储核心功能实现、性能调优方法论及容灾备份方案,结合真实企业级案例演示如何通过分层存储、冷热数据管理、多AZ部署等技术手段满足PB级数据存储需求,特别针对容器化部署、API二次开发、成本优化等场景提供完整解决方案,配套开发实战代码与架构图解,助力开发者从零构建高可用、高扩展的对象存储系统,适合云架构师、大数据工程师及企业IT管理者参考使用。
(总字数:约3120字)
第一章 对象存储技术全景解读(426字) 1.1 对象存储发展沿革 对象存储技术自2006年由Amazon S3开创以来,经历了三次重大技术迭代:
- 第一代(2006-2012):基于Web服务化架构的早期实践
- 第二代(2013-2018):分布式架构标准化(如 erlang + ring架构)
- 第三代(2019至今):多模态融合阶段(对象+块+文件存储统一管理)
2 核心技术指标对比 | 指标维度 | 对象存储 | 传统存储 | 分布式存储 | |----------|----------|----------|------------| | 存储成本 | $/TB/年 | $/GB/年 | $/PB/年 | | 存取性能 | O(1) | O(n) | O(log n) | | 并发能力 | 10^5+/s | 10^3/s | 10^4/s | | 数据保留 | 永久化 | 3-5年 | 10年 | | 扩展方式 | 水平扩展 | 竖直扩展 | 混合扩展 |
3 典型应用场景矩阵 构建三维应用场景评估模型:
- 数据生命周期(热/温/冷)
- 并发访问特征(突发/持续/间歇)
- 数据一致性要求(强一致性/最终一致性)
- 成本敏感度(ROI周期<12个月)
第二章 架构设计方法论(598字) 2.1 企业级架构设计四要素
图片来源于网络,如有侵权联系删除
- 弹性扩展层:基于Kubernetes的动态扩缩容(案例:阿里云OSS自动扩容实例)
- 数据路由层:多区域容灾架构(AWS S3 Cross-Region Replication)
- 存储引擎层:混合存储策略(Ceph对象池+Alluxio缓存)
- 安全审计层:区块链存证(Hyperledger Fabric应用实践)
2 典型架构模式比较
- 单一云架构:成本优化但容灾风险(适用于初创企业)
- 多云架构:业务隔离但管理复杂(金融行业首选)
- 网络文件系统:数据统一但性能损耗(媒体行业适用)
3 容灾设计黄金标准
- RPO=0(即时复制)
- RTO<15分钟(灾备切换)
- 数据零丢失(审计日志保留)
- 业务连续性(自动故障切换)
第三章 开发实战与SDK深度解析(672字) 3.1 API调用优化技巧
- 批量上传:Multipart Upload(最大10^6 objects)
- 大文件分片:Range Request(支持10PB级文件)
- 延迟策略:Tagging + Lifecycle Policy组合
- 性能调优:预签名URL + 热缓存策略
2 SDK二次开发指南
- 高并发处理:令牌桶算法实现(QPS>10^5)
- 数据加密:国密SM4算法集成(代码示例)
- 分布式锁:Redis + OSS组合方案
- 监控埋点:Prometheus + Grafana可视化
3 开源生态实战
- MinIO集群部署(Docker + Kind环境)
- MinIO Gateway配置(Nginx反向代理)
- MinIO统一存储(对象/块/文件三模合一)
- MinIO Serverless架构(FaaS集成)
第四章 运维优化秘籍(614字) 4.1 性能调优五步法
- 网络带宽分级:区分冷热数据网络通道
- 缓存策略优化:LRU算法改进(命中率提升40%)
- 存储后端适配:Ceph RGW vs Alluxio
- 节点均衡算法:基于IOPS的负载均衡
- 请求合并策略:HTTP/3多路复用
2 安全防护体系
- 基础安全:TLS 1.3 + AES-256加密
- 身份认证:OAuth2.0 + JWT组合
- 审计追踪:操作日志分析(ELK Stack)
- 风险控制:WAF + DDoS防护
3 能耗优化方案
- 硬件选择:液冷服务器(PUE<1.1)
- 动态休眠:基于负载预测的休眠策略
- 存储介质:3D XPoint混合存储
- 能效计算:TCO模型优化(案例:某视频平台年省电费$2.3M)
第五章 企业级应用案例(710字) 5.1 视频流媒体平台架构
图片来源于网络,如有侵权联系删除
- 框架设计:Kafka + Flink实时处理
- 存储方案:冷媒体归档(Ceph对象池)
- 流量分发:CDN +边缘计算(Anycast)
- 监控体系:视频质量检测(AI质检)
2 金融风控系统实践
- 数据架构:实时数据湖(对象+流式)
- 监控指标:99.99% SLA保障
- 容灾方案:双活+同城双活
- 合规审计:数据血缘追踪
3 智能制造平台建设
- 工业物联:10^6+设备接入
- 数据存储:时间序列数据库(TDengine)
- 存储优化:数据压缩(ZSTD算法)
- 分析引擎:Delta Lake对象存储集成
第六章 未来技术演进(286字) 6.1 技术融合趋势
- 存算分离:存算分离架构(Google冷数据层)
- 智能存储:AIops预测性维护(故障预警准确率92%)
- 绿色存储:碳足迹追踪(ISO 14064标准)
2 核心技术突破
- 存储即服务(STaaS):API抽象层
- 分布式事务:Raft协议优化(吞吐提升3倍)
- 存储网络:RDMA技术集成(延迟<1μs)
第七章 常见问题解决方案(428字) 7.1 高并发场景处理
- 分片策略:对象分片数与性能关系(100-1000片最佳)
- 缓存穿透:布隆过滤器+缓存雪崩防护
- 限流降级:令牌桶算法实现(QPS>10^5)
2 数据恢复方案
- 快照恢复:秒级数据恢复(成本优化30%)
- 备份策略:3-2-1多地备份
- 容灾演练:全链路演练(RTO<5分钟)
3 性能瓶颈突破
- 网络瓶颈:多网卡负载均衡(TCP BBR优化)
- 存储瓶颈:SSD与HDD混合部署
- CPU瓶颈:异步IO处理(epoll优化)
附录:技术资源包(略) 严格遵循原创原则,所有技术参数均来自公开资料二次加工,架构设计案例基于企业级项目经验总结,代码示例经过脱敏处理,实际应用需根据具体业务场景进行参数调优,建议参考官方文档进行生产环境部署。)
本文链接:https://www.zhitaoyun.cn/2208599.html
发表评论